A COMPREHENSIVE SERIES OF ARTICLES ON THIS TOPIC
your community
news
Thu, 26 Sep, 2024
Fri, 20 Sep, 2024
Tue, 20 Aug, 2024
Wed, 14 Aug, 2024
an hour ago
2 hours ago
3 hours ago